This package can be used to generate [JSON Schemas](http://json-schema.org/latest/json-schema-validation.html) from Go types through reflection.
- Supports arbitrarily complex types, including `interface{}`, maps, slices, etc.
- Supports json-schema features such as minLength, maxLength, pattern, format, etc.
- Supports simple string and numeric enums.
- Supports custom property fields via the `jsonschema_extras` struct tag.

## Configurable behaviour
The behaviour of the schema generator can be altered with parameters when a `jsonschema.Reflector`
instance is created.
### ExpandedStruct
If set to ```true```, makes the top level struct not to reference itself in the definitions. But type passed should be a struct type.

### PreferYAMLSchema
JSON schemas can also be used to validate YAML, however YAML frequently uses
different identifiers to JSON indicated by the `yaml:` tag. The `Reflector` will
by default prefer `json:` tags over `yaml:` tags (and only use the latter if the
former are not present). This behavior can be changed via the `PreferYAMLSchema`
flag, that will switch this behavior: `yaml:` tags will be preferred over
`json:` tags.
With `PreferYAMLSchema: true`, the following struct:
```go
type Person struct {
FirstName string `json:"FirstName" yaml:"first_name"`
}
```
would result in this schema:
```json
{
"$schema": "http://json-schema.org/draft-04/schema#",
"$ref": "#/definitions/TestYamlAndJson",
"definitions": {
"Person": {
"required": ["first_name"],
"properties": {
"first_name": {
"type": "string"
}
},
"additionalProperties": false,
"type": "object"
}
}
}
```
whereas without the flag one obtains:
```json
{
"$schema": "http://json-schema.org/draft-04/schema#",
"$ref": "#/definitions/TestYamlAndJson",
"definitions": {
"Person": {
"required": ["FirstName"],
"properties": {
"first_name": {
"type": "string"
}
},
"additionalProperties": false,
"type": "object"
}
}
}
```
### Custom Type Definitions
Sometimes it can be useful to have custom JSON Marshal and Unmarshal methods in your structs that automatically convert for example a string into an object.
To override auto-generating an object type for your struct, implement the `JSONSchemaType() *Type` method and whatever is defined will be provided in the schema definitions.
Take the following simplified example of a `CompactDate` that only includes the Year and Month:
```go
type CompactDate struct {
Year int
Month int
}
func (d *CompactDate) UnmarshalJSON(data []byte) error {
if len(data) != 9 {
return errors.New("invalid compact date length")
}
var err error
d.Year, err = strconv.Atoi(string(data[1:5]))
if err != nil {
return err
}
d.Month, err = strconv.Atoi(string(data[7:8]))
if err != nil {
return err
}
return nil
}
func (d *CompactDate) MarshalJSON() ([]byte, error) {
buf := new(bytes.Buffer)
buf.WriteByte('"')
buf.WriteString(fmt.Sprintf("%d-%02d", d.Year, d.Month))
buf.WriteByte('"')
return buf.Bytes(), nil
}
func (CompactDate) JSONSchemaType() *Type {
return &Type{
Type: "string",
Title: "Compact Date",
Description: "Short date that only includes year and month",
Pattern: "^[0-9]{4}-[0-1][0-9]$",
}
}
```
The resulting schema generated for this struct would look like:
```json
{
"$schema": "http://json-schema.org/draft-04/schema#",
"$ref": "#/definitions/CompactDate",
"definitions": {
"CompactDate": {
"pattern": "^[0-9]{4}-[0-1][0-9]$",
"type": "string",
"title": "Compact Date",
"description": "Short date that only includes year and month"
}
}
}
```

package jsonschema
import (
"fmt"
"io/fs"
gopath "path"
"path/filepath"
"strings"
"go/ast"
"go/doc"
"go/parser"
"go/token"
)
// ExtractGoComments will read all the go files contained in the provided path,
// including sub-directories, in order to generate a dictionary of comments
// associated with Types and Fields. The results will be added to the `commentsMap`
// provided in the parameters and expected to be used for Schema "description" fields.
//
// The `go/parser` library is used to extract all the comments and unfortunately doesn't
// have a built-in way to determine the fully qualified name of a package. The `base` paremeter,
// the URL used to import that package, is thus required to be able to match reflected types.
//
// When parsing type comments, we use the `go/doc`'s Synopsis method to extract the first phrase
// only. Field comments, which tend to be much shorter, will include everything.
func ExtractGoComments(base, path string, commentMap map[string]string) error {
fset := token.NewFileSet()
dict := make(map[string][]*ast.Package)
err := filepath.Walk(path, func(path string, info fs.FileInfo, err error) error {
if err != nil {
return err
}
if info.IsDir() {
d, err := parser.ParseDir(fset, path, nil, parser.ParseComments)
if err != nil {
return err
}
for _, v := range d {
// paths may have multiple packages, like for tests
k := gopath.Join(base, path)
dict[k] = append(dict[k], v)
}
}
return nil
})
if err != nil {
return err
}
for pkg, p := range dict {
for _, f := range p {
gtxt := ""
typ := ""
ast.Inspect(f, func(n ast.Node) bool {
switch x := n.(type) {
case *ast.TypeSpec:
typ = x.Name.String()
if !ast.IsExported(typ) {
typ = ""
} else {
txt := x.Doc.Text()
if txt == "" && gtxt != "" {
txt = gtxt
gtxt = ""
}
txt = doc.Synopsis(txt)
commentMap[fmt.Sprintf("%s.%s", pkg, typ)] = strings.TrimSpace(txt)
}
case *ast.Field:
txt := x.Doc.Text()
if typ != "" && txt != "" {
for _, n := range x.Names {
if ast.IsExported(n.String()) {
k := fmt.Sprintf("%s.%s.%s", pkg, typ, n)
commentMap[k] = strings.TrimSpace(txt)
}
}
}
case *ast.GenDecl:
// remember for the next type
gtxt = x.Doc.Text()
}
return true
})
}
}
return nil
}
